PMICs serving as power supply controllers and monitors regulate and monitor various parameters of power supplies, such as output voltage, current, and efficiency. They offer features like voltage regulation, current limiting, overvoltage protection, and power sequencing to ensure stable and reliable operation of power supply systems in diverse applications.
